Exact solutions of the space time-fractional Klein-Gordon equation with cubic nonlinearities using some methods

Published 1 Jun 2020 in nlin.SI | (2006.00832v3)

Abstract: Recently, finding exact solutions of nonlinear fractional differential equations has attracted great interest. In this paper, the space time-fractional Klein-Gordon equation with cubic nonlinearities is examined. Firstly, suitable exact soliton solutions are formally extacted by using the solitary wave ansatz method. Some solutions are also illustrated by the computer simulations. Besides, the modified Kudryashov method is used to construct exact solutions of this equation.
